The first China New Cultural and Creative Fair & Trendy Toy Carnival opens today in Beijing’s Chaoyang Park, running through May 24. This 10-day free event features over 10,000 products from 171 exhibitors across all 31 provinces, including major institutions like the Palace Museum. Under the theme “Culture for Harmony, Creativity for Life, Trendy for the Future,” the fair blends traditional heritage with contemporary design, showcasing everything from ancient-inspired jewelry to modern designer toys.
Beyond the displays, the carnival offers over 100 live performances, mecha parades, and traditional dragon dances across multiple stages. Centered at the Chaoyang Museum of Urban Planning and the Weibo IN complex, the event aims to boost cultural consumption and provide a new platform for China’s creative industries.
